Cross into Botswana for a full day in Chobe National Park — the closest big-game park to Livingstone and one of Africa's great wildlife destinations. Leaving your hotel in the morning and returning in the evening, you'll experience Chobe from both water and land in a single unforgettable day.
The morning brings a three-hour river safari along the Chobe River, where elephants come down to drink and cross, hippos and crocodiles laze in the shallows, and the banks teem with birdlife.
